Guidelines for Conducting a Health Impact Assessment for Local Alcohol Planning. (AL638)

Health Impact Assessment is a tool that can be used to assist local alcohol planning. HIA can be used in many different policy settings, including the development of alcohol strategies and liquor control bylaws. It may also be used to address a specific alcohol-related issue such as outlet density or trading hours of licensed premises.

Alcohol and your kids. What can you do? (AL801)

Many of us are concerned that at some stage we, and our teens, will come face to face with the issue of alcohol and teenage drinking.

This resource from HPA provides parents and care givers with helpful advice, and includes tips about delaying drinking, being a role model, building and maintaing a good relationship and what to do when things go wrong.

A DVD resource is also included with the booklet, it contains three videos that illustrate some of these helpful tips.

Alcohol - the Body & Health Effects, A brief overview (AL802)

This resource provides a brief overview of the the health and body effects of alcohol. Areas covered include the effects of alcohol on body parts, the health effects of acute alcohol use, the health conditions related to chronic alcohol use, and the effects of alcohol on other people and populations.

Low-risk drinking advice is also outlined in the resource along with information about where to find support and further information.

Guidelines for Crime Prevention through Environmental Design (CPTED) for licensed premises (AL634)

These guidelines have been developed to establish and maintain a safe and secure environment in all licensed premises. The guidelines should assist those involved in the design, development and refurbishment of licensed premises, as well as those wishing to implement their principles in existing premises.
